Everton FC is gearing up to strengthen their squad this summer, and according to a recent report from TEAMtalk, they have set their sights on Luton Town’s Elijah Adebayo. The 6-foot-5 striker has impressed Wayne Rooney with his physicality and goal-scoring prowess, and Sean Dyche believes he could be the perfect addition to his team.

Adebayo’s stats speak for themselves – he scored 10 goals in just 26 Premier League games last season, outscoring both Dominic Calvert-Lewin and Beto. His aerial ability and strength on the ball make him a formidable opponent, and his work rate is exactly what Dyche demands from his players.

Everton’s interest in Adebayo is no surprise, given their need for more firepower up front. Calvert-Lewin’s future is uncertain, with just one year left on his contract, and offloading him might be the only option if he refuses a new deal. Adebayo would be a shrewd signing to replace him, and his physicality would bring a new dimension to Everton’s attack.

Luton Town’s relegation has made Adebayo available at a cut price, and Everton is poised to step up their pursuit once they generate some much-needed cash from player sales. This would be a smart move, given their current financial situation, and Adebayo’s quality would make him an excellent addition to the squad.

Adebayo has already caught the eye of Wayne Rooney, who tried to sign him for Derby County in 2022. Rooney praised Adebayo’s strength, aerial ability, and work rate, saying he was a “handful” to play against. These traits are exactly what Dyche looks for in his strikers, and Adebayo’s style of play would suit Everton’s system perfectly.

Everton has a history of snapping up talent from relegated teams, with Dwight McNeil, Abdoulaye Doucouré, James Tarkowski, and Jordan Pickford all joining from teams that went down. Adebayo would follow in their footsteps, and his signing would be a coup for the Toffees.
